Teaching Materials and Administration

The Teaching and Administration series is divided into 3 sections: course materials, administration and miscellaneous university documents. The series contains correspondence to or from Paul Pedersen, lecture/course materials and examples, assignments, examinations (blank and marked), student records and grades, and miscellaneous documents pertaining to courses taught. It also contains documents, information and correspondence to or from Paul Pedersen with respect to administration while employed at McGill University and the University of Toronto, respectively. The series is arranged chronologically, and separated by course name or subject as indicated.

Biographical Information

The Biographical Information series consists of divergent materials, all relating to either Pedersen’s personal or professional life. The series includes: personal legal documents, early education, thesis and dissertation writings, writings for lectures, documents pertaining to professional engagements, grant applications, and other miscellaneous personal documents.
